    Job Responsibilities:

    • Conduct thorough physical examinations and assessments to diagnose and treat a variety of musculoskeletal conditions, ensuring accurate and effective care.
    • Design and implement personalized treatment plans that address each patient's unique needs, focusing on long-term health and recovery.
    • Provide high-quality primary care services, emphasizing preventive care, wellness promotion, and holistic patient management.
    • Administer advanced manual therapies, including trigger point therapy, to alleviate pain, improve mobility, and enhance overall function.
    • Utilize a strong understanding of human anatomy and physiology to guide informed treatment decisions and optimize patient outcomes.
    • Collaborate with a multidisciplinary healthcare team to deliver comprehensive, patient-centered care.

    Key Qualifications:

    • Expertise in conducting comprehensive physical examinations and assessments with a focus on musculoskeletal health.
    • Proficient understanding of medical terminology and its application in patient diagnosis and treatment.
    • Familiarity with medical imaging and its interpretation, ensuring effective integration into treatment planning.
    • Solid foundation in occupational health principles and practices, with an emphasis on injury prevention and rehabilitation.
    • Ability to offer primary care services within the scope of chiropractic practice, promoting overall health and wellness.
    • Skilled in performing trigger point therapy and other manual techniques for effective pain relief and enhanced mobility.
    • In-depth knowledge of human anatomy and its direct application to chiropractic treatments and interventions.
    •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, to foster clear, compassionate, and effective interactions with patients and healthcare teams.

    This position requires a chiropractic license in the state of practice. Candidates must have completed a Doctor of Chiropractic (D.C.) degree from an accredited institution.
